Cationic Starch

#
Modified starch


Cationic starch is a modified starch, mainly used as wet-end starch. Cationic starch is positively charged, and is easily attracted by the negatively charged cellulose fiber and fillers. As a result fiber-to-fiber and fiber-to-filler bond are increased. Hence improves the retention of fines and filler and also increases the paper sheet strength.
